Control y Monitoreo de afecciones en los cultivos

Last uploaded: April 3, 2019






Details
Acronym AGROCYMAC
Visibility Public
Description Agrocymac es una ontología creada para estructurar información sobre el control y monitoreo de plagas, malezas y enfermedades que afectan específicamente a los cultivos de Arroz, Café y Cacao.
